Output 12812081ab31b13a6d476e6f7c715b20374b245828a5f21fa814e718052cde4b:0

value
315886093080
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 170d5fbe9ef8c9622e650704cd2f9fbb3203ef2c OP_EQUALVERIFY OP_CHECKSIG
address
D7Ez6usxXn4PpHJoxftKbPFACaHqLAnmRG
transaction
12812081ab31b13a6d476e6f7c715b20374b245828a5f21fa814e718052cde4b